I found it unfortunate when i saw the score ratings on the main page, and not even in the thread.
Even unpopular posts, despite how many that turn up troll, deserve to be seen. Is this downvote, upvote system going to hide those?
Why should only threads people have deemed worthy be able to hold onto the top page?
if you need upvotes to do that, then that means you can't even bump neutral thread anymore (a thread that doesn't get a lot of posts, but is 0>posituve in upvotes)
These "forums" need to take into account the people who aren't making stories or keeping onto the latest bandwagon trend. Making the threads themselves (and not just the posts) require votes seems like it could very much lead to a very "black/white" thread listing with little in between.
Either you're on the communities side, or you fall to obscurity.